数据库的表有什么内容
-
数据库的表是数据库中的基本组成单元,用于存储和组织数据。每个表由一系列的列(字段)和行(记录)组成。表的内容取决于具体的应用需求和数据模型设计,但通常包含以下内容:
-
列名(字段名):表的每一列都有一个唯一的名称,用于标识和访问该列。列名应具有描述性,清晰明确,以便于理解和使用。
-
数据类型:每个列都有一个数据类型,用于定义该列可以存储的数据的类型。常见的数据类型包括整数、浮点数、字符串、日期时间等。数据类型的选择应根据存储数据的特点和需求进行合理的选择。
-
约束:表中的列可以定义各种约束条件,用于限制数据的取值范围和有效性。常见的约束包括主键约束、唯一约束、非空约束、默认值约束等。约束可以保证数据的完整性和一致性。
-
关系:在关系型数据库中,表与表之间可以建立关系,通过关系连接可以进行数据的查询和操作。常见的关系有一对一关系、一对多关系和多对多关系。
-
索引:为了提高数据的检索效率,表中的某些列可以创建索引。索引可以加快数据的查找速度,但会占用额外的存储空间。索引的选择应根据具体的查询需求和数据量进行合理的考虑。
除了上述内容,表还可以包含其他一些辅助信息,如表的注释、创建时间、修改时间等。总之,数据库的表的内容是根据具体应用需求和数据模型设计来确定的,可以根据需求进行灵活的调整和扩展。
1年前 -
-
数据库的表可以根据具体的需求和业务场景来设计,每个表都有自己的字段和数据类型。一般来说,一个表代表一个实体或者一个概念,可以存储相关的数据。
以下是一些常见的表和它们可能包含的字段:
- 用户表:存储用户的信息,如用户名、密码、邮箱、电话等。
- 商品表:存储商品的信息,如商品名称、价格、库存、分类等。
- 订单表:存储订单的信息,如订单号、下单时间、付款时间、订单状态等。
- 购物车表:存储用户的购物车信息,如用户ID、商品ID、数量等。
- 地址表:存储用户的地址信息,如用户ID、收货人、地址、电话等。
- 文章表:存储文章的信息,如文章标题、内容、发布时间、作者等。
- 评论表:存储用户对文章或商品的评论,如评论内容、评论时间、用户ID等。
- 日志表:存储系统的操作日志,如操作类型、操作时间、操作用户等。
- 配置表:存储系统的配置信息,如网站标题、Logo、默认设置等。
- 员工表:存储公司员工的信息,如员工ID、姓名、职位、部门等。
除了上述常见的表外,根据具体业务需求还可以设计其他表,如图片表、分类表、权限表等。
总之,数据库的表的内容根据具体需求和业务场景而定,设计合理的表结构可以提高数据的存储效率和查询效率。
1年前 -
数据库的表是由一系列行和列组成的二维数据结构,用于存储和组织数据。每个表都有一个表名,并且包含多个列和行。表中的列定义了表中存储的数据的属性,而行则表示表中的一个记录。
数据库的表可以包含各种各样的内容,具体内容的设计取决于数据库的用途和需求。下面是一些常见的表内容:
-
用户表(User Table):用于存储用户的基本信息,如用户名、密码、电子邮件地址等。
-
商品表(Product Table):用于存储商品的信息,如商品名称、价格、库存量等。
-
订单表(Order Table):用于存储订单的信息,如订单号、下单时间、订单状态等。
-
客户表(Customer Table):用于存储客户的信息,如客户姓名、联系方式、地址等。
-
员工表(Employee Table):用于存储员工的信息,如员工编号、姓名、职位等。
-
学生表(Student Table):用于存储学生的信息,如学生编号、姓名、年龄等。
-
教师表(Teacher Table):用于存储教师的信息,如教师编号、姓名、职称等。
-
文章表(Article Table):用于存储文章的信息,如文章标题、内容、作者等。
-
评论表(Comment Table):用于存储用户对文章或商品的评论信息,如评论内容、评论时间、用户ID等。
-
日志表(Log Table):用于存储系统的日志信息,如日志时间、日志内容、操作人等。
以上只是一些常见的表内容,实际的表内容设计应根据具体的业务需求和数据结构来确定。在设计数据库表时,需要考虑数据的完整性、一致性和查询效率等因素,以便能够更好地满足业务需求。
1年前 -